On 28th June 1914, Archduke Franz Ferdinand and his wife were assassinated in Serbia.

1/ Archduke Franz Ferdinand with his wife Sophie, Duchess of Ho The group behind the killings was The Black Hand Secret Society, formed by Dragutin Dimitrijevi´c, the Serbian Chief of Intelligence.

His goal: create a covert terrorist group using violence to achieve a Greater Serbian state.

2020 had me thinking: was it THIS BAD in the year 1010? What happened then, in that palindrome-year?

Let’s have a look around the world.

The Nile River in #Egypt froze over. Literally froze over.

1 of 18 It was the 2nd time only (the 1st in 829 CE).

English climatologist HH Lamb (1966) deduced Siberian-origin anticyclones blew south and then north, which caused the cold air to contract, get denser, weigh more, and thus increase surface air pressure over the Nile.

Oleander (Lat: Nerium oleander; family Apocynaceae ) is

** the most poisonous plant in the world**. Image Every single part of the oleander is toxic. The leaves, stems, and flowers.

They don't just contain 'a' poison. They contain 'MANY' types of poison.

The most potent of these are oleandrin, and neriine.

Oleander will cause dangerous heart arrhythmias (irregular heartbeats). Image

In 1918, the influenza pandemic — Spanish flu — spread throughout the world. By 1920, ⅓ of the world's population had been contaminated, and 10s of millions died.

Conspiracy theories then (WWI) were rife:

* It was unleashed by the Germans via submarines sailing the world * It was blamed on foreigners (pick a country: find the 'bad foreigner')

* It was said to be from Spain ('Spanish' = 'bad foreigner') but it originated on a farm in Kansas

* Enemy bombs dropped unleashed 'buried pathogens'

* It was a biological weapon linked to Bayer aspirin

How do dominant political houses of power rise and fall in history? Ibn Khaldun (14th c.) — the 1st sociologist — identified 4 stages:

1st unification under a zealous portion of the population to form a new ‘order’;
2nd consolidation by spreading zeal amongst population;

1/8
3rd prevention of a counter rebellion via a strong economy to ensure the leaders’ longevity;
4th decline/loss of power when the population has tired of promises and zealotry.

Did you know the first university in the world was built by a Muslim woman approx 1200 years ago?

This is the story of Fatima Al-Fihiri (800–880 CE). #BadassWoman #twitterstorians

1/15 2. Daughter of a wealthy businessman, the family moved from Tunisia to Fez, Morocco during the rule of King Idriss II. When both her husband and father died, Fatima and her sister inherited a fortune.

They chose to spend their inheritance on building educational institutions.

The ‘atfa was the 'cradle' of camel bones, and inside was piled with blankets and pillows. Curtains would surround for privacy, and when moving it felt like gentle rocking.

Many Bedouin women gave birth whilst on migration in this way.
